According to Wikipedia, "The term public intellectual "describes the intellectual participating in the public-affairs discourse of society, in addition to an academic career." The editor of this blog frequently cites Wikipedia definitions of important concepts, but he was surprised and disappointed by the narrow academic focus of its definition in this case. Ezra Klein is not a tenured professor in a university and does not have a PhD, the union card usually required for admission to tenure. But neither did Walter Lippmann, one of this nation's first and most eminent public intellectuals

"Pandemic Survivor" -- Does anybody still watch that show?
Last update: Tuesday 7/26/22
Is that show still on? Does anybody really watch it anymore? I haven't watched since last Christmas. Who are the main characters now? Remember way back in 2020 when "Masks" and "Other Mitigations" were the good guys and we all tuned in every week to watch them flatten the curves?... "Masks" and "Other Mitigations" were pushed out in early 2021 by "Vaccines" and "Herd Immunity". When ratings began to sag, CDC Productions replaced them with bad guys, "Delta" and "Breakthroughs". Nobody like them, so CDC tried to bring back "Masks"and "Other Mitigations", which didn't work out. After Christmas they replaced "Delta" with "Omicron". He was supposed to be a good guy because he was less lethal than Delta, yet somehow he killed more people. I remember feeling confused and bored and suddenly noticed that I had gained 15 pounds from watching too much TV; so I decided to go out more and get more exercise and fresh air. That's when I learned that Netflix announced that it would cancel its contract with CDC Productions before the fall 2022 season began. Meanwhile, is anybody still watching the show?
